Sorry, this listing is no longer accepting applications. Don’t worry, we have more awesome opportunities and internships for you.

Software Developer (DevOps)

CapTech Consulting

Software Developer (DevOps)

Philadelphia, PA +5 locations
Full Time
Paid
  • Responsibilities

    Job Description

    As a Software Developer (DevOps) you will work within the engineering team to drive the way we deploy, verify, and monitor applications and services. In addition to hands-on systems engineering, you will work with all stakeholders to help define DevOps processes and shape the development culture. You will assist in the ongoing improvement of continuous integration tools, environment provisioning, and development workflows. You will ensure that we have appropriate levels of monitoring and alerting set up for all our applications across our mix of physical servers, private and public cloud. 

    SPECIFIC RESPONSIBILITIES AS SOFTWARE DEVELOPER (DEVOPS) INCLUDE:

    • Build strong relationships across development and operations teams to understand the code, its dependencies, and the infrastructure on which it runs.
    • Build and maintain systems that will monitor all aspects of the application and the infrastructure.
    • Lead the definition of the team’s strategy for SDLC automation, configuration management, and release management.
    • Be the team expert in deployment strategy (CI/CD) and automation.
    • Contribute to software development as needed.
  • Qualifications

    Qualifications

    REQUIRED SKILLS

    • Bachelor's degree in Computer Science, Software Engineering, MIS or equivalent combination of education and experience
    • Must be very comfortable working with both developers and system administrators
    • Experience with source code management tools such as Subversion and Git
    • Proficiency with at least one modern programming language Python, Go, Node.js.etc
    • Proficiency in cross-platform scripting languages and build tools (ANT, Artifactory, Groovy, Maven, MSBuild, Nexus, NuGet)
    • Experience deploying and administering Continuous Integration tools such as Jenkins, TFS, TeamCity, or Bamboo
    • Experience creating infrastructure automation solutions with tools such as Terraform, CloudFormation, Ansible, Chef, Puppet, etc.
    • Experience and understanding of Agile development.
    • Experience troubleshooting distributed systems.
    • MUST BE LOCATED IN ONE OF THE FOLLOWING STATES:  Arizona, Colorado, Connecticut, Delaware, Florida, Georgia, Illinois, Iowa, Kansas, Kentucky, Maine, Maryland, Massachusetts, Michigan, Minnesota, Missouri, Nevada, New Jersey, New York, North Carolina, Ohio, Oklahoma, Pennsylvania, Rhode Island, South Carolina, Tennessee, Texas, Virginia, Washington, Washington, DC, Wisconsin.

    PREFERRED SKILLS

    • Experience as hands-on Application Software Developer
    • Experience with automated testing solutions for unit testing, integration testing, and system testing
    • Understanding of strategies for providing high availability and security
    • Understanding of deployment strategies using container orchestration tools such as Kubernetes, Amazon ECS, etc.
    • Experience with XaaS like Amazon Web Services, Azure, OpenShift
    • Excellent communication and collaboration skills
    • Excellent problem-solving skills
    • Must be self-directed and thrive in a fast-paced and collaborative culture

    Additional Information

    We provide challenging and impactful opportunities in our client work and internal teams, while keeping individual interests in mind. We want everyone at CapTech to be able to envision a lifelong career here, which is why we offer a variety of career paths based on your skills and passions. As a CapTecher, you will experience exciting and rewarding roles that help you grow and make a difference, while having fun along the way.

    At CapTech we offer a competitive and comprehensive benefits package including, but not limited to:

    • Competitive salary with performance-based bonus opportunities
    • Three comprehensive Medical Plan options (PPO and HDHP), as well as Dental and Vision coverage
    • Company paid basic Life and AD&D, Short-Term and Long-Term Disability Insurance
    • Matching 401(k)
    • Cell Phone stipend
    • Competitive Paid Time Off
    • Paid Birth and Family Bonding Leave
    • Adoption Assistance
    • Training and Certification opportunities eligible for expense reimbursement
    • Team building and social activities
    • Mentor program to help you develop your career

    CAPTECH IS AN EQUAL OPPORTUNITY EMPLOYER COMMITTED TO FOSTERING A CULTURE OF EQUALITY, INCLUSION AND FAIRNESS — EACH FOUNDATIONAL TO OUR CORE VALUES.  WE STRIVE TO CREATE A DIVERSE ENVIRONMENT WHERE EACH EMPLOYEE IS ENCOURAGED TO BRING THEIR UNIQUE IDEAS, BACKGROUNDS AND EXPERIENCES TO THE WORKPLACE. FOR MORE INFORMATION ABOUT OUR DIVERSITY, INCLUSION AND BELONGING EFFORTS, CLICK HERE.

    AT THIS TIME, CAPTECH CANNOT TRANSFER NOR SPONSOR A WORK VISA FOR THIS POSITION. APPLICANTS MUST BE AUTHORIZED TO WORK DIRECTLY FOR ANY EMPLOYER IN THE UNITED STATES WITHOUT VISA SPONSORSHIP.

    • Candidates must be eligible to work in the U.S. for any employer directly (we are not open to contract or “corp to corp” agreements). 
    • CapTech is a Drug-Free workplace.
    • Candidates must have the ability to work at CapTech’s client locations. 
    • Some positions may require travel.
    • CapTech has not contracted/does not contract with any outside vendors in its recruitment process. If you are interested in this position, please apply to CapTech directly.

    #LI-DG1

  • Locations
    Atlanta, GA • Chicago, IL • Charlotte, NC • Columbus, OH • Philadelphia, PA • Richmond, VA